One thing you have to consider before choosing the style of hardwood flooring is the moisture content of your basement. You need to make sure that your basement isn’t prone to water leaks or flooding. Colorado is no stranger to extreme weather. When it’s not heavy snowfall in the winter, we’ve got hail season in the spring, and monsoon season in the late summer. And all bring potential problems for basements.

Engineered flooring is best for rooms below ground

Once you’ve determined that you teenager isn’t going to be floating around in the basement, you can move on to choosing the type of flooring you want. If you’re going for hardwood flooring in your basement, we advise you to choose engineered flooring. It’s resistance to the naturally high and fluctuating humidity levels in a basement or below grade room makes engineered floors the best choice.

But, engineered floors can be just as classic and beautiful as solid hardwood floors, so don’t be fooled into thinking that just because they are man made, they are inferior to solid wood floors.
